How do you write sequences to different files instead of writing them all to one file?

A) EMBOSS is not good at writing multiple sequences to different files. You could try using 'nthseq' to pull out one sequence at a time.

You should consider using the '-ossingle' qualifier. This writes sequences to separate FASTA files, but the file names depend on the sequence ID. This is rarely used. It is there because -ossingle is the default for GCG output format. The output filename is currently ignored when ossingle is used, and the filename depends on each individual sequence.
